#438056 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#438056 is composed of 26.3% red, 50.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 138.7 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 38.2%. #438056 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ffac with #000100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#438056 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#438056 has RGB values of R:67, G:128,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4423766.

Shades and Tints of #438056
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c08 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#438056
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616261 is the less saturated color, while #07bc3f is the most saturated one.
